Key elements of the technician field service report template
The technician field service report template covers essential details of a service visit. Here are the main components of this template:- Customer details: This section captures the customer's name, address, and contact information. Accurate customer details are crucial for follow-ups and maintaining a professional relationship.
- Service details: Here, you’ll document the time and date of the service, along with a detailed description of what happened. This allows you to track the work done and any subsequent actions needed.
- Equipment details: This section includes fields for equipment make, model, serial number, and condition. Recording this information helps in maintaining an up-to-date inventory and identifying recurring issues with specific equipment.
- Technician observations: Note down the reported issue, root cause identified, and parts replaced. This section is vital for diagnosing problems accurately and ensuring that the right solutions are applied.
- Technician recommendations: This includes recommendations for follow-up services or equipment replacement. Providing clear recommendations helps in proactive maintenance and avoiding future breakdowns.
- Customer acknowledgment: This signifies that the customer agrees with the service performed and the observations made.
Best practices for using a technician field service report template
Implementing a technician field service report template effectively will enhance your documentation process. Here are some tips for maximizing the template:- Prioritize real-time reporting. Ideally, the report would be filled out immediately after service completion. Real-time documentation reduces the risk of forgetting crucial details and leads to better accuracy.
- Attach supporting evidence. Whenever possible, include photos, signatures, and other relevant documents. This not only provides proof of service but also aids in visualizing the reported issues.
- Use clear and concise language. Minimize jargon and ambiguous terms. With clear descriptions, anyone reading the report can understand the issues and actions taken without confusion.
